HOMOIOPLASTIC ADRENAL GRAFTS TO THE CEREBRAL CORTEX OF THE RAT

Abstract
A technique is described for grafting adrenals from new born rats to the cerebral cortex of adult animals. This method was found successful in protecting bilaterally adrenalectomized hosts. Histological examination of such animals, killed after more than 5 mos., revealed complete differentiation of adrenal cortex grown in brain tissue.
